Home
last modified time | relevance | path

Searched refs:structurally_symmetric (Results 1 – 12 of 12) sorted by relevance

/petsc/src/mat/impls/baij/mpi/
H A Dmpiaijbaij.c18 …ool3 sym = A->symmetric, hermitian = A->hermitian, structurally_symmetric = A->structurally_symmet… in MatConvert_MPIAIJ_MPIBAIJ() local
37 A->structurally_symmetric = structurally_symmetric; in MatConvert_MPIAIJ_MPIBAIJ()
/petsc/src/mat/impls/centering/
H A Dcentering.c76 (*C)->structurally_symmetric = PETSC_BOOL3_TRUE; in MatCreateCentering()
/petsc/src/mat/impls/cdiagonal/
H A Dcdiagonal.c374 A->structurally_symmetric = PETSC_BOOL3_TRUE; in MatCreate_ConstantDiagonal()
/petsc/src/mat/interface/
H A Dmatrix.c5924 …etry_eternal && mat->ass_nonzerostate != mat->nonzerostate) mat->structurally_symmetric = PETSC_BO… in MatAssemblyEnd()
6105 mat->structurally_symmetric = PETSC_BOOL3_TRUE; in MatSetOption()
6115 if (flg) mat->structurally_symmetric = PETSC_BOOL3_TRUE; in MatSetOption()
6122 if (flg) mat->structurally_symmetric = PETSC_BOOL3_TRUE; in MatSetOption()
6128 mat->structurally_symmetric = PetscBoolToBool3(flg); in MatSetOption()
6136 …PetscCheck(mat->structurally_symmetric != PETSC_BOOL3_UNKNOWN, PetscObjectComm((PetscObject)mat), … in MatSetOption()
8596 …if ((*newmat)->symmetric == PETSC_BOOL3_UNKNOWN && (*newmat)->structurally_symmetric == PETSC_BOOL… in MatCreateSubMatrix()
8630 B->structurally_symmetric = A->structurally_symmetric; in MatPropagateSymmetryOptions()
9558 if (A->structurally_symmetric != PETSC_BOOL3_UNKNOWN) { in MatIsStructurallySymmetric()
9559 *flg = PetscBool3ToBool(A->structurally_symmetric); in MatIsStructurallySymmetric()
[all …]
/petsc/src/mat/utils/
H A Dgcreate.c111 B->structurally_symmetric = PETSC_BOOL3_UNKNOWN; in MatCreate()
/petsc/src/mat/impls/diagonal/
H A Ddiagonal.c697 A->structurally_symmetric = PETSC_BOOL3_TRUE; in MatCreate_Diagonal()
/petsc/include/petsc/private/
H A Dmatimpl.h478 PetscBool3 symmetric, hermitian, structurally_symmetric, spd; member
/petsc/src/ksp/pc/impls/gamg/
H A Dgamg.c514 if ((*Gmat2)->structurally_symmetric == PETSC_BOOL3_TRUE) { in PCGAMGSquareGraph_GAMG()
/petsc/src/mat/impls/sbaij/seq/
H A Dsbaij.c1823 B->structurally_symmetric = PETSC_BOOL3_TRUE; in MatCreate_SeqSBAIJ()
/petsc/src/mat/impls/aij/seq/
H A Daij.c203 if (symmetric && A->structurally_symmetric != PETSC_BOOL3_TRUE) { in MatGetRowIJ_SeqAIJ()
231 if ((symmetric && A->structurally_symmetric != PETSC_BOOL3_TRUE) || oshift == 1) { in MatRestoreRowIJ_SeqAIJ()
/petsc/src/mat/impls/sbaij/mpi/
H A Dmpisbaij.c2148 B->structurally_symmetric = PETSC_BOOL3_TRUE; in MatCreate_MPISBAIJ()
/petsc/src/mat/impls/aij/mpi/
H A Dmpiaij.c7991 …PetscCall(MatAXPY(Gmat, 1.0, matTrans, Gmat->structurally_symmetric == PETSC_BOOL3_TRUE ? SAME_NON… in MatCreateGraph_Simple_AIJ()